Components of Membrane Buttons



Membrane switches are made up of several vital elements that collaborate to develop a dependable and useful user interface. The key elements include the graphic overlay, sticky layer, spacer layer, and conductive traces.


The graphic overlay acts as the individual interface, generally printed on an adaptable substratum such as polyester or polycarbonate. This layer not just gives visual allure yet additionally consists of responsive comments, visual cues, and protective features. Beneath the graphic overlay exists the sticky layer, which protects the button to the gadget and guarantees toughness versus ecological tensions.


The spacer layer is important for maintaining the necessary space between the visuals overlay and the circuit layer. When stress is applied, this gap permits for the activation of the button. The conductive traces, typically made from silver or carbon, form the electrical paths that finish the circuit when the switch is involved.


Additionally, a support layer may be consisted of for architectural support and insulation. These elements work together flawlessly, making sure that Membrane buttons are both durable and straightforward, making them indispensable in different modern digital applications.




How Membrane Switches Job



Exactly how do Membrane Switches function properly within digital devices? Membrane Switches operate on the concepts of pressure-sensitive modern technology, making use of a split building and construction that includes visuals overlays, adhesive layers, and conductive elements. When an individual applies pressure to the button, the leading layer warps, permitting the conductive components below to make call and complete an electric circuit. This action sets off the wanted function within the tool.


The style of Membrane switches is essential for their reliable operation (membrane switches). The layers are thoroughly crafted to provide responsive responses, sturdiness, and resistance to ecological aspects such as moisture and dirt. The incorporation of domes-- small, raised areas within the button-- boosts responsive feedback, offering customers with a noticeable click feeling upon activation

Applications in Modern Tools



Utilizing their unique layout and functionality, Membrane switches have actually ended up being important elements in a vast array of modern-day digital tools. These versatile interfaces are utilized in customer electronics, commercial equipment, medical gadgets, and vehicle controls, supplying smooth user communication.


In consumer electronics, Membrane switches are Check Out Your URL frequently located in devices like microwaves, cleaning devices, and other home devices, where they make it possible for user-friendly control with a smooth profile. Their low-profile design assists in assimilation into compact devices, boosting visual charm without compromising performance.


In commercial applications, Membrane Switches offer as control board for machinery, supplying longevity and resistance to rough atmospheres. Their ability to hold up against wetness and pollutants makes them optimal for use in production and processing industries.


Clinical devices also gain from Membrane buttons, which are developed to be easy to tidy and keep, making certain hygiene in medical setups. They are typically used in analysis equipment, client tracking systems, and portable medical devices, where integrity is critical.
